Cirque II Softshell Pant

If 'vertical' is a word that appears in your everyday vocabulary, then the Outdoor Research Women's Cirque Softshell Pants want to catch some altitude with you. Made for days in the mountains when waterproof hard-shell pants would be too stuffy but regular hiking pants wouldn't provide enough protection, the Cirque pants are crafted with a water-resistant, double-weave stretch fabric that shields you from mist and doesn't mind the occasional spring skiing day. The trim fit lies comfortably under a harness during summer alpine missions, and a durable scuff guard adds a layer of defense against crampon points and ski edges. Multiple pockets accommodate your essentials while you move up in the world.


Details

  • Performance soft shell pants for demanding cold weather endeavors
  • Stretch fabric provides unrestricted movement, resists weather
  • Soft shell classification offers exceptional breathability
  • Harness compatible waist keeps you comfortable and prepared
  • Gusseted crotch and ankles, and articulation boost movement
  • Reinforced scuff guards enhance durability and longevity
  • Zippered hand and thigh pockets keep important items nearby
  • Runs large, so we recommend sizing down for ideal fit

Material
50% nylon, 43% polyester, 7% spandex
Seams
not sealed
Fit
standard
Inseam
32in
Pockets
2 zippered hand, 2 zippered thigh
Waist
adjustable tabs
Side Zips
ankle
Claimed Weight
1lb 4.5oz
Manufacturer Warranty
lifetime

These pants were perfect for a cold day with 40mph winds and 15 degree windchill hiking at 12,000 feet in the alpine in January. They were totally windproof and I was actually warm when we were ascending, but perfect temperature when descending. They fit fairly narrow, so if you are planning on layering underneath I would recommend sizing up. The velcro at the hips helps customize sizing and I really love the higher rise on the waist. These are my go to pants for non-skiing winter adventures.

Horrible downgrade

I bought these because I had a pair of the original Cirque that I would have died for...but I HATE this version. - Sizing is bizarre. They are about FOUR inches longer than the previous model and insanely tight compared to the Cirque I in the same size. - No good place to put your phone. They got rid of the back pocket, so you can put it in your front pocket (where it rubs your thigh and digs into your lower abdomen with every step), or in the RH thigh pocket - see next point. - RH thigh pocket is useless for anything that's not soft - because the pants are so much longer, the bottom of the pocket is at the knee and anything in the pocket rubs a raw spot on my knee. It gets more than 1 star because it still mostly functions the way I need it to, but I can't wait for them to wear out so I can replace them with a Cirque III...which I hope has returned to the original configuration.
